    • A cordless telephone has several mobile elements (MTn) allocated to a fixed element (FT). In order to establish a connection between the fixed element (FT) and one of the mobile elements (MTn), an incoming call (AR) is converted to an outgoing call. The exchange of the required communication data occurs exclusively over speech channels. An identification code with group or individual identification is emitted by the fixed element (FT) as an identification message (KMn) with a call message (RM). The call is signalled by the mobile parts (MTn) connected to one group. Call-indicator messages (RAM) are sent back one by one on a free channel. The fixed element (FT) monitors the channels until an established-connection message (VAM) is sent by a mobile element (MTn), a fork switch having been actuated. Said mobile part (MTn) thereby initiates the establishment of a connection. The fixed part (FT) can also call one mobile part (MTn) after another individually. Each mobile part (MTn) sends back on the same channel the call-indicator message (RAM) and, after the fork switch has been actuated, the established-connection message (VAM).

    • An antenna for the transmitter and receiver of a portable radio appliance (cordless telephone, mobile telephone, pager, telepoint appliance, etc.) consists essentially of two sheet metal angles (2, 3) arranged side by side. One of the two elements is excited with high-frequency currents by means of a coaxial supply line (4). The second sheet metal angle (3) is excited through radiation coupling by the first sheet metal angle (2). The sheet metal angles (2, 3) are aligned in the same direction and the distance between them in the end region is considerably less than in the bent edge of the apex line. This results in high cross-currents and low impedance. The antenna can also be modified by supplying both sheet metal angles (2, 3), subdivision into two identical partial antennae or several sheet metal angles. The sheet metal angles can consist of metal foils placed on a plastic housing. An embodiment with wire angles is also possible.
